Prozac Patent Expiry and Exclusivity


The patent for Prozac, the brand name for fluoxetine, has long expired, allowing for the production of generic versions of the drug. Eli Lilly and Company, the original developer, held patents that protected their market exclusivity for a period.

When Did Prozac's Patents Expire?


The primary patents for Prozac began to expire in the late 1990s and early 2000s. This marked the beginning of generic competition for the antidepressant.

How Did Generic Prozac Become Available?


Once the key patents expired, other pharmaceutical companies were able to manufacture and market generic versions of fluoxetine. This typically leads to a significant decrease in the drug's price.

Who Makes Generic Prozac?


Numerous pharmaceutical manufacturers produce generic fluoxetine. These companies include major generic drug producers, and their products are available through most pharmacies.

What is the Difference Between Brand-Name Prozac and Generic Fluoxetine?


The main difference lies in the manufacturer and the inactive ingredients used. The active ingredient, fluoxetine, is chemically identical in both brand-name Prozac and its generic equivalents. Regulatory bodies ensure that generic drugs are bioequivalent to their brand-name counterparts, meaning they should work the same way in the body [2].
